Abstract

This experiment examined whether the time of day of alcohol administration influences alcohol metabolism and the impact of alcohol on verbal memory. It was hypothesized that circadian fluctuations in endogenous levels of testosterone in young men would differentially affect blood alcohol levels, which would consequently impair their memory performance to a different degree. Participants were administered alcohol or placebo drinks either at 8am or 6pm and recall of 4 prose passages was examined. The results indicated that recall declined for subjects administered alcohol but time of day did not moderate these effects. Nevertheless, generally alcohol breath levels changed in the predicted direction as a function of the time of the day with higher levels recorded in the morning and lower levels in the afternoon. The results suggested that observed differences in breath alcohol levels may be influenced by differences in endogenous levels of testosterone, but the effect of this presumed interaction on verbal memory appears inconclusive.
